Padre Pio, Pandemic Saint: The Effects Of The Spanish Flu And Covid-19 On Pilgrimage And Devotion To The World’S Most Popular Saint, Michael A. Di Giovine

International Journal of Religious Tourism and Pilgrimage

In the Catholic world, pilgrimages and other devotional rituals are often undertaken to foster healing and well-being. Thus, shrines dedicated to saints are particularly relevant in times of pandemic. Pilgrimage to the shrines associated with 20th century Italian stigmatic, St. Padre Pio of Pietrelcina, known as one of the Catholic world’s most popular saints, is particularly informed by this notion, as Pio is understood as a healing saint thanks to the spiritual and corporal works of mercy that marked his ministry during his lifetime, as well as belief in the miraculous nature of his relics. Interdisciplinarity As A Means Of Doing Theology: Jose Mario Francisco, Jr., Sj, Phd And His Writings, Ruben C. Mendoza

Theology Department Faculty Publications

As a Jesuit, Jose Mario Francisco has occupied various positions in the academe as a teacher and an administrator. At the same time, he has engaged in research on various topics such as Asian theology, religious identity, Christology, literary theory, Philippine literature in English, translation, and hermeneutics. A thread that runs through his writings is his interdisciplinary approach to the subject of his inquiry. A particular interest of Francisco in his efforts to understand Filipino Catholicism is his emphasis on mission as translation which for him necessarily involves interpretation.

Reframing Joseph Cardinal Bernardin’S Consistent Ethic Of Life In The Light Of The Crisis Of Our Common Home And Pope Francis’ Integral Ecology, Anatoly Angelo R. Aseneta

Theology Department Faculty Publications

The article is based from the a defended dissertation of the same title. As raised by Pope Francis in Laudato Si’ and as evidenced by the various ecological problems we face, the crisis of our common home harms both non-human and human life. It is becoming more evident that to consistently defend human life inevitably means caring for our common home.
